 When Princess Diana died on August 31, 1997, she left behind the two sons she loved more than anything in the world

 She was a very hands on mum, breaking countless royal rules and traditions by smothering her boys with affection, kisses and cuddles in public whenever she could

 So when she passed away, it was only right that her fortune and her most prized possessions would be passed onto them

 However they were just teenagers at the time, so they money was kept safe until they were old enough to know what to do with such a huge amount money

 She left £12,966,022 which was reduced to £8,502,330 after death duties.  However years of clever investments by royal advisors meant this had swelled to more than £20million by the time it came back to her boys

 The huge amount came from the ­settlement she got in her divorce from Prince Charles, shares, jewellery, cash, and personal items from her Kensington Palace home

 The money was shared equally between her two sons - even though though William will inherit his father's money-spinning Duchy of Cornwall when he becomes Prince of Wales

 The princes got some of the money when they turned 25, but they had to wait until they were 30 for the full sum

 They both paid huge amounts of inheritance tax when they received the money, and William reportedly faced a 40 per cent bill

  Speaking just before Prince Harry's 30th in 2014, a royal insider told the Mirror : "There is no way Harry would dodge the tax

 "There are few similarities between the average person and Harry and William but when it comes to tax, they also have to pay their way

 "William got hit with a hefty bill when he turned 30 and so will Harry. His aides have to work out the most tax-efficient way for him to handle the money

"  But it wasn't just cash which Diana passed onto her sons, and she also left them many of her most treasured items

 The most famous of these was her wedding dress, which the boys inherited when Prince Harry turned 30

 Until the landmark birthday, Diana's brother looked after the stunning David and Elizabeth Emanuel dress, which is one of the most iconic dresses in history

 After Diana's the boys were taken to choose a "keepsake" from her belongings in Kensington Palace, according to reports from a source 'close to the Royals'

 William picked her Cartier watch while Harry chose her sapphire and diamond engagement ring

 But when William decided it was time to pop the question to Kate Middleton, Harry made a touching sacrifice and gave it to his big brother so he could pass it onto his new bride-to-be

For those who are unaware, the stated occupancy for all buildings is a

combination of the building code and fire codes. The International Building

Code, known as 'IBC', is a solid point of reference but can be superseded by local

codes because it's regarded as the minimum acceptable standard.

The local fire official has the final stamp of approval of stated occupancies. For this

discussion, the building of interest will be a one-story 4,700 square foot, non-sprinkled

restaurant-bar and the IBC is what I'll be referencing.

As defined in the IBC, restaurants and bars fall under the use and classification of 'Assembly Group A-2'

and the most basic governing limitation is the quantity of egresses,

known as exits. Fire safety is at the core of all building codes and egress

is the first criteria we need to address.

The following table stipulates the

number of exits for various occupancies: 0-49 - one exit, 50 - 500 - two exits,

501 to 1,000 - three exits and >1,000 - four exits.

The general guidelines for floor area allowances per occupant for A-2 Assembly

is as follows: concentrated chairs only (not fixed) -

7 square feet per patron;

standing space only - 5 square feet

and unconcentrated tables and chairs - 15 square feet.

When calculating occupancy we do not use one calculation for the entire building.

We need to apply the occupancy rules for

each of the various areas to attain accurate calculations.

Consider the 4,700 square foot, one-story non-sprinkled sports bar-restaurant shown here.

The following is an evaluation of each seating area in the 'front-of-the-house':

the reception area is a 30 square foot space in the vestibule; IBC allows us to

factor five square feet per patron as this as a standing space; this yields a

total occupancy of six. We would only be allowed seven square per patron

if this were chairs-only.

For the bar, we cannot include the area

inside the bar in our calculation - only the number of seats around the perimeter, which is 29.

The overall area of the bar and adjacent 'Bar Dining' is 1,393 sq.ft.,

but in order to calculate the occupancy for 'Bar Dining', we must deduct

the area of the bar, which is 410 sq.ft.

This leaves us a net calculation of 983 sq.ft.

and according to IBC, for areas with tables and chairs,

we need to allocate 15 sq.ft. per patron in this area,

which yields an occupancy of 65.

The fourth area of this facility is the Dining Room.

Again, in order to calculate occupancy, we can all use the 'net area', as

depicted within this border, which is 681 sq.ft., and because we're using

tables and chairs the occupancy for the Dining Room is 45.

The VIP Room, which is 183 sq.ft., and has tables

and sofas. We again apply 15 sq.ft. per patron for a total of 12.

If the Dining Room were a dance floor,

IBC would allow 5 square foot per patron, which would yield an occupant

load of 136 in that area. On the other hand, if an owner wished to operate the

dining room space as a dance floor on weekends, the local fire official may

only grant the most restrictive occupancy of 45.

If this were a fine dining facility, many owners

would likely create a more comfortable open space by

allocating 18-20 sq.ft. per patron, which would reduce the occupant load to 34-37.

Back to the example at-hand, to calculate the tentative

occupancy of this building, we simply tally the occupant loads from each

given area, for a total of 157.

The Building Code is constantly evolving.

According to my good friend, architect

Tom Kuhn of CKS Architects, as of 2018

IBC now requires businesses in Occupancy A-2

that serve alcohol, any new or existing

modified fire area over 1,500 sq.ft. would be required

to have sprinklers, if you want to meet the current code without implementing

workaround design parameters available in Chapter 34.

 Since her days on Sex and the City, Sarah Jessica Parker has appeared to be the ultimate shoe fanatic

Her character, Carrie Bradshaw, collected — and walked around in — heels that got more trendy (and more expensive!) with each and every episode

And eventually, long after the show's ending, her obsession enabled her to create her own line, SJP by Sarah Jessica Parker, which consists of heels, flats, Mary Janes and more

 But according to the actress, her fascination with the accessory began long before she landed a role as a fashion-obsessed NYC woman on the iconic television show

And in an interview with Gwyneth Paltrow on Paltrow's new Goop podcast, explaining her longtime love for all kinds of shoes, which dates back to when she was a young girl living in Cincinnati

 "I've always loved them but not in the way that Carrie Bradshaw loved them," she tells Paltrow in the interview

"I didn't know you could love shoes and then have them, you know? When I was living in Cincinnati, there was a shoe store in this place called Kenwood which was a pretty serious drive from our neighborhood

But we went twice a year. We went at the end of August for our school shoes for the year, and then we would go, we would get fall/winter shoes and then spring/summer shoes

So we got two pairs of shoes a year, and then we had a pair of Mary Jane's — proper Mary Janes

But if my sister outgrew hers then I would just get my sister's."  The actress, who is one of eight children, explains how much the trips to that shoe store fascinated her: the smell of leather, the cold air conditioning in the summer and the blasting heat in the winter

 "In those days, there weren't anything but leather shoes. It did't matter how much money you had, there weren't the Targets of the world or the Walmarts," she explains

"These were mom and pop independently owned shoe stores. I really would pick up all the shoes and I would smell them and I would look at the stitching on the soles, I would look at the sock liners, I would fantasize knowing full well what shoe my mom was going to make me get, but they were beautiful

It smelled so incredible and I loved my new shoes. Even if they really weren't the shoes I wanted, I loved a new pair of shoes

"  But the ritual of shopping for the accessories isn't the only prominent childhood memory she has about them

Parker says she and her siblings also learned how to take care of them, in order to make sure they lasted throughout the entire year

 "My mom got out newspaper and every Sunday, she got out the Kiwi shoe polish and we were all lined up and we had to polish our own shoes every Sunday to keep them as nice as we could cause we weren't getting another pair

"  Little did she know back then that one day she'd not only have access to the most mesmerizing shoes on the market, but she'd also create some of those shoes on her own — a task that she was very careful about when the time came

 "A while after the show ended, and I think even after I did the second movie, a bunch of companies were asking if I'd consider going into business with them and it was very exciting and I was very flattered and I had lots of very interesting meetings with big shoe people, but they all wanted me to make the shoes in China and sell them for $69, $99 and those margins were incredibly seductive for everybody and it just meant, like, we would all be rich

," she tells Paltrow, explaining that she  "just had a hard time saying yes."  But after having lunch with a group of businesswomen, she decided to seek out her own partnership, which ended up landing her the company she has now: SJP by Sarah Jessica Parker

 "We were talking about stuff and the shoe category came up and one of them said to me, 'well what do you want to do?' And I said, "well what I really want to do is to go into business with George Malkemus III but he's already spoken for, he's the CEO of Manolo [Blahnik]

"  Parker continues, "They were like, have you asked him? And they said just ask him

"  So she did. After leaving the restaurant, she got Malkemus on the phone — and the answer was an immediate "yes

"  "I got a phone and I went outside and I called George and I said, "George I know this is a long shot but would you go into business with me?' And he said, 'be at my office tomorrow morning 9am
